package ch.ethz.inf.vs.californium.plugtests.tests;
import ch.ethz.inf.vs.californium.coap.BlockOption;
import ch.ethz.inf.vs.californium.coap.CoAP.ResponseCode;
import ch.ethz.inf.vs.californium.coap.CoAP.Type;
import ch.ethz.inf.vs.californium.coap.Request;
import ch.ethz.inf.vs.californium.coap.Response;
import ch.ethz.inf.vs.californium.plugtests.PlugtestChecker;
import ch.ethz.inf.vs.californium.plugtests.PlugtestChecker.TestClientAbstract;
public class CB01 extends TestClientAbstract {
// Handle GET blockwise transfer for large resource (early negotiation)
public final ResponseCode EXPECTED_RESPONSE_CODE = ResponseCode.CONTENT;
public CB01(String serverURI) {
super(CB01.class.getSimpleName());
Request request = Request.newGet();
request.getOptions().setBlock2(BlockOption.size2Szx(64), false, 0);
// set the parameters and execute the request
executeRequest(request, serverURI, "/large");
}
@Override
protected boolean checkResponse(Request request, Response response) {
boolean success = response.getOptions().hasBlock2();
if (!success) {
System.out.println("FAIL: no Block2 option");
} else {
int maxNUM = response.getOptions().getBlock2().getNum();
success &= checkType(Type.ACK, response.getType());
success &= checkInt(EXPECTED_RESPONSE_CODE.value,
response.getCode().value, "code");
success &= checkOption(new BlockOption(PlugtestChecker.PLUGTEST_BLOCK_SZX,
false, maxNUM), response.getOptions().getBlock2(),
"Block2");
success &= hasNonEmptyPalyoad(response);
success &= hasContentType(response);
}
return success;
}
}
